Cryptopolitan on MSNU.S. Senate passes the GENIUS Act on June 17 in a 68–30 voteOn June 17, the U.S. Senate approved the GENIUS Act by a 68-30 vote, marking the first major cryptocurrency bill to pass the Senate. With backing from some Democrats, Republican Senator Bill Hagerty led the bill through the Senate on Tuesday.
